The 2024 EuroCup Finals will be the concluding games of the 2023–24 EuroCup season, the 22nd season of Euroleague Basketball's secondary level professional club basketball tournament, the 16th season since it was renamed from the ULEB Cup to the EuroCup, and the first season under the new title sponsorship name of BKT. The first leg will be played at the Adidas Arena arena in Paris, France, on 9 April 2024, the second leg will be played at the Ekinox in Bourg-en-Bresse, France, on 12 April 2024 and the third leg, if necessary, will be played again at the Adidas Arena arena in Paris, France, on 15 April 2024, between French sides Paris Basketball[1] and Mincidelice JL Bourg.[2]
Background
It will be the first all–French final series in the history of the EuroCup and the second all–French final series in the history of the European club basketball tournaments after the 2017 FIBA Europe Cup Finals in which Nanterre 92 defeated Élan Chalon for achieve their second continental crown.[3]
It will be the first ever Finals appearance in the competition for Paris Basketball. It will be also the first time that any team from the French capital will play an European final. Until this season, the best Parisian performance was the 1996–97 season of the European second–tier level FIBA EuroCup semifinal played by Paris Basket Racing in which it was defeated by Real Madrid that finally won the title.[4][5]
It will be the first ever Finals appearance for Mincidelice JL Bourg in EuroCup. It will be also the first time that JL Bourg will play an European final and will become the 14th French team to qualify for an European final.[6][7]
